Roosevelt is a locality in Kiowa County, Oklahoma, United States. It is a small community with a population of 213. The population density is 169.6 people per km². Roosevelt is located at 34.8487°N, 99.0217°W. It observes the Central Time (America/Chicago) timezone. ZIP code: 73564.

It lies 39.5 miles west-north-west of Lawton, OK (from Lawton, OK: bearing 295°T), and is situated 13.1 miles south-south-east of Hobart.
